Kashipur, Feb. 25 -- The Indian Institute of Management (IIM) Kashipur successfully concluded its flagship entrepreneurship summit, Uttishtha'25, on February 24, 2025.
The two-day event featured extensive discussions, competitions, and start-up showcases that brought together industry leaders, entrepreneurs, investors, and students.
Organised in collaboration with the Foundation for Innovation and Entrepreneurship Development (FIED) and with support from the Ministry of Agriculture & Farmers' Welfare, Government of India, the summit attracted more than 10,000 participants, including over 200 Agri startups, Micro, Small and Medium Enterprises (MSMEs), and Farmer Producer Organisations (FPOs).
